General CTD Notes - data acquisition notes, logistics, processing - see below. Please note that these regressions are generated from preliminary CTD vs bottle data and will NOT be reprocessed since final bottle data will not be processed. This was a test cruise and minimal bottle samples were collected. CTD sensor data are good and have been processed normally. Both primary & secondary sensor profiles vs bottle data have been generated and archived in the downloadable CTD+Bottle data files. These plots are under the "csv-plots\Primary" & "csv-plot\Secondary" subdirectories. Please note: if re-processing the CTD raw cast data, the RV Sally Ride deck unit used was misconfigured, offsetting the primary and secondary conductivity 0.73sec instead of 0.073sec. An offset of -0.657sec should be applied using AlignCTD to calculate salinity correctly. These will not be imported into the CalCOFI database or processed into final form. They are provided as an archive. |
